Webull (NASDAQ:BULL) launched mutual funds for IRA accounts, expanding its long-term investing and retirement solutions for U.S. users. Eligible IRA customers can now access diversified, professionally managed mutual funds directly on the platform, initially in beta for select users, with a full rollout to all IRA accounts planned.

Key features include no-load mutual funds, expanded diversification options, and improved flexibility for retirement investors. The mutual fund lineup will grow over time through additional funds and CUSIPs, and support for ACAT transfers of mutual fund positions is expected in a future release.

Recent Company History

Over recent months, Webull has combined financial growth with platform and capital markets activity. Q1 2026 revenue reached $159.9 million with a GAAP net loss of $21.7 million, and a $100 million buyback program was authorized for the next 12 months. The company also removed Pattern Day Trader restrictions, which preceded an 11.17% gain, and filed its Form 20‑F with audited 2025 results. Today’s IRA-focused mutual fund launch continues a pattern of broadening product offerings alongside ongoing corporate and regulatory milestones.

mutual funds financial
"Webull ... announced the launch of mutual funds for IRA accounts, expanding its suite"
A mutual fund is a pooled investment where many people combine their money so a professional manager can buy a mix of stocks, bonds or other assets on their behalf. Think of it as a shared basket that spreads risk across many holdings while offering easier access and ongoing management; it matters to investors because it provides diversification, professional oversight and simple buy/sell access, though returns and fees vary.
ira accounts financial
"announced the launch of mutual funds for IRA accounts, expanding its suite"
An IRA account is a tax-advantaged personal savings account designed to help people invest for retirement; think of it as a special piggy bank that gives you tax breaks to encourage long-term saving. Different IRA types change when you pay taxes and when you can take money out, so they matter to investors because the choice affects your after-tax returns, portfolio decisions, and the timing of withdrawals during retirement.
no-load mutual funds financial
"Availability of no-load mutual funds for retirement investors"
A no-load mutual fund is an investment pool you can buy or sell without paying a sales commission or front-end/back-end charge, so the entire amount you invest goes to buying shares of the fund. For investors this matters because lower up-front costs can improve net returns over time—like a store that lets you shop without an entrance fee—though you should still check ongoing management fees and performance before investing.
acat transfers financial
"Support for ACAT transfers of mutual fund positions is also expected"
ACAT transfers are the automated process that moves a complete brokerage account — including cash, stocks, bonds and other holdings — from one financial firm to another using a standardized industry system. Investors care because it makes switching brokers like moving a bank account instead of packing boxes: it preserves positions and tax lots, reduces paperwork and delays, and can affect when you can trade or access funds during the move.
cusips technical
"expand through the addition of new funds and CUSIPs, providing investors"
A CUSIP is a unique nine-character code assigned to stocks, bonds and other U.S. and Canadian securities that works like a barcode, letting traders, brokers and databases identify a specific issue quickly and without confusion. Investors rely on CUSIPs to match trades, settle transactions, track holdings and find official documents, so correct CUSIP use helps prevent errors and ensures records and regulatory filings point to the exact security.

New offering provides IRA customers access to diversified, professionally managed investment products within the Webull platform

NEW YORK, June 5,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- Webull (NASDAQ: BULL), an online investment platform, today announced the launch of mutual funds for IRA accounts, expanding its suite of long-term investing and retirement solutions for U.S. users.

This new offering gives eligible IRA customers access to professionally managed mutual funds, enabling investors to build more diversified portfolios directly within the Webull platform. The launch represents another step in Webull's continued expansion of investment products designed to support a broader range of investor needs and long-term financial goals.

Mutual Funds pool investor capital into diversified portfolios of stocks, bonds, and other securities managed by professional portfolio managers. They are commonly used for retirement and long-term investing because they provide diversification, simplified portfolio construction, and access to professionally managed investment strategies.

"Expanding access to mutual funds within IRA accounts allow investors to more easily diversify their portfolios and manage their retirement savings through a single platform," said Lindsay Ryan, Head of U.S. Products. "By bringing more investment choices into one streamlined experience, we're helping clients simplify long-term financial planning and stay focused on achieving their goals."

The launch is designed to support investors contributing to retirement accounts, rolling over retirement assets, or looking to diversify their long-term portfolios through professionally managed products.

Key features of the offering include:

  • Access to diversified, professionally managed mutual funds within eligible IRA accounts
  • Availability of no-load mutual funds for retirement investors
  • Expanded portfolio diversification options for long-term investing strategies
  • Improved flexibility for retirement investors holding mutual fund positions

Mutual Funds have launched in beta for select U.S.-based customers, with a full rollout to all IRA accounts coming soon. The available fund lineup will continue to expand through the addition of new funds and CUSIPs, providing investors with a broader range of investment options. Support for ACAT transfers of mutual fund positions is also expected in a future release.

About Webull Corporation

Webull Corporation (NASDAQ: BULL) owns and operates Webull, a leading digital investment platform built on next-generation global infrastructure. Through its global network of licensed brokerages, Webull offers investment services in 16 markets across North America, Asia Pacific, Europe, Africa and Latin America. Webull serves more than 27 million registered users globally, providing retail investors with 24/7 access to global financial markets. Users can put investment strategies to work by trading global stocks, ETFs, options, futures, fractional shares, and digital assets through Webull's trading platform, which seamlessly integrates market data and information, its user community, and investor education resources.
